HYDERABAD, Dec 29: Sindh High Court Hyderabad circuit bench here on Friday issued another contempt of court notice to Anti Terrorism Court (ATC) judge requiring him to explain as to why contempt proceedings should not be initiated against him for flouting high court's order.

The court directed him to submit his explanation by January 5, 2007 and directed the jail authorities to produce detained person namely Abdul Qayoom before the court on the said date. The court also put the Additional Advocate General (AAG) Masood A.Noorani on notice in the matter.

The matter pertained to criminal miscellaneous application filed by Mohammad Sajid Baloch, seeking recovery of his brother, Abdul Qayoom, who he said was picked-up by Tando Adam police and kept in wrongful confinement since November 21.

He said that Tando Adam police raided applicant's house and took away his brother while misbehaving with womenfolk and added police did not have any lawful reason to conduct search.

SHO police stations Tando Adam, in-charge investigation, SP investigation Sanghar and DPO Sanghar were cited as respondents in the matter.

The applicant said that SHO Alan Abbasi told him to pay Rs30,000 as it were to be paid to one Khalid Mustafa otherwise “your brother would be implicated in false cases or killed in an staged encounter”.

He said that since then the detainee was being tortured by police and respondents were not allowing them to meet him. He added that he filed application before sessions judge Sanghar on November 28 but he preferred to call report from police despite the fact that he requested him that in the meantime the respondents would shift the detainee to some other place or implicate him in some other case. He added that later the detainee was shifted to Sinjhoro police station.

On December 27 the court appointed Ghulam Murtaza Shah, a reader of the court, as raid commissioner and directed him to release the detainee upon surety of personal bond in case he was found in illegal detention and if any proof of arrest was available then raid commissioner should record his statement and direct SHO to produce him before the court on December 29.

Following his raid on December 27 at the police station the raid commissioner submitted his report, apprising the court that he found the detainee in fetters in a room of police station Tando Adam. The detainee told him that he was in illegal custody of police for the last two months and he was kept at different police stations of the district adding that he had just been brought from Tando Mitha Khan.

SHO Tando Adam informed the raid commissioner that he was required in crime no 20/06 of police station Bhittai Nagar. However, the raid commissioner noted that he was not nominated in the FIR but his name was placed in challan sheet in the column of absconder. The court official directed TPO Zafar Iqbal Awan and SHO to produce him before court on December 29.
